Alberta Finance Minister Joe Ceci Holds Up Dad's Old Workboots As Symbol Of Budget

Darpan News Desk The Canadian Press, 26 Oct, 2015 11:12 AM
    EDMONTON — Alberta Finance Minister Joe Ceci is continuing a tradition of new shoes on budget day, but he's trotting out a near-and-dear old pair of workboots.
     
    Ceci says the brown, worn boots were worn by his father, who was a house builder.
     
    He says he kept them as a keepsake after his father died in 2008.
     
    Ceci says the shoes symbolize hard work and are meant to emphasize that Tuesday's budget will help and protect Alberta families.
     
    The NDP has said the budget will run a deficit of almost $6.5 billion, but will also stabilize public services and spur infrastructure building.
     
    New shoes for a new budget have become a Canadian parliamentary tradition, but the origin is unclear.
